Application of general-purpose radiation transport code into study for laser-produced plasma ions acceleration

Sakaki, Hironao; Sato, Tatsuhiko   ; Kai, Tetsuya   

A general-purpose Monte Carlo particle and heavy ion transport code system (PHITS), which consists of various quantum dynamics models, was used to study laser-driven ion acceleration. Our simulation reasonably predicted not only the laser-driven ion's trajectories detected by the monitors but also the radiation shielding of these particles.
